Starting with Comfort and Convenience
The tour kicks off with a pickup from your hotel in Downtown Toronto or nearby Airport hotels, making it easy to start your day without the hassle of navigating public transport or calling cabs. The private vehicle (a sleek Mercedes van or minibus) guarantees a comfortable ride through the city, with bottled water onboard to keep you refreshed.
Visiting the Iconic CN Tower
The highlight for many is the CN Tower, one of Toronto’s most recognizable landmarks. Your ticket provides priority access to the LookOut Level and Glass Floor, meaning no long lines and more time to enjoy the views. Standing on the Glass Floor, you’ll get an adrenaline rush as you look straight down to the city streets below—an experience that’s both thrilling and visually impressive.
From the LookOut Level, panoramic vistas stretch across Toronto’s skyline, Lake Ontario, and beyond, offering perfect photo opportunities. Reviewers often mention “the views are breathtaking,” and that the skip-the-line entry makes the visit less stressful than going solo.
Seasonal Harbour Cruise or Casa Loma
Depending on the time of year, your tour offers a seasonal Toronto Harbour Boat Cruise—a scenic, one-hour ride that highlights Toronto’s waterfront, skyline, and historic ships. This adds a relaxed, scenic dimension to the day, especially in warmer months.
In winter or off-peak seasons, the cruise is replaced with a visit to Casa Loma, Toronto’s famous castle-style mansion. This switch allows you to explore a historic site with impressive architecture and charming gardens, providing a different but equally memorable experience.

Next, you’ll hop into your private vehicle for a guided city drive. The route covers Toronto’s top landmarks, such as Nathan Phillips Square, where the iconic Toronto sign awaits, and Old City Hall—a striking example of historic architecture. You’ll also pass the University of Toronto, Queens Park, and Dundas Square, each adding layers to your understanding of Toronto’s diverse neighborhoods.
The guide provides insights into Toronto’s history, culture, and urban development, making the sights come alive. One review mentions that the guide’s commentary “made the city’s landmarks feel more meaningful,” which is exactly what you want from a private tour.

Photo Stops and Local Flavors
There’s plenty of time built in for photo opportunities, especially at the Toronto sign, and at key viewpoints. The tour also includes a visit to St. Lawrence Market—a foodie’s paradise—and, on weekends, the Distillery District. When the market is closed on Sundays and Mondays, the tour adapts by visiting the lively, artsy Distillery District instead.
Guests can wander, browse local stalls, or grab a snack. The market’s vibrant atmosphere and the distillery’s historic charm add authentic Toronto flavor to your day.
End of Tour and Flexibility
The tour concludes with drop-off back at your hotel or airport, wrapping up a comprehensive, relaxed day. Since the tour is private, you can request slight adjustments or additional time at certain sites if desired—though the 5-hour window keeps things efficiently paced.

FAQ
Is the tour suitable for all ages?
Yes, the tour is designed for a wide age range, but some sites like the CN Tower’s Glass Floor might be less appealing to very young children or those with a fear of heights.
Can I customize the itinerary?
Since it’s a private tour, you can request slight adjustments, such as more time at specific landmarks or a different stop if available, though the main highlights are included as standard.
What should I wear?
Comfortable shoes are recommended as there will be walking and photo stops. Weather-appropriate clothing is advised since some parts are outdoors.
Are meals included?
No, meals are not included, but you’ll have time at St. Lawrence Market or the Distillery District to grab a bite.
How long does the CN Tower visit last?
Access to the LookOut Level and Glass Floor is included, with no mention of time limits, so you can enjoy the views at your pace.
What is the cancellation policy?
You can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, providing flexibility if your plans change.
